75 Bvt. Maj. Gen. Fisk Asst. Comr. Ky. & Tenn. J.E. Jacobs. Bvt. Lt. Col. & A.A.G. Trimble, Col. Supt. &c. Sumner Co. Tenn. Endorsement on letter of J. Drain, dated Davidson Co. Feb. 25 1866, asking justice from his former master L.R. D.37. A.C. Ky. & Tenn. 1866. Bureau R.F. & A.L. Asst. Comr. Office, Nashville, Feb. 28' 1866 Respectfully returned to Col. Trimble, Supt. Sumner Co. who is instructed to see that complete justice is done to the complainant. The Asst. Comr. cannot give his personal attention to cases of the kind, but must rely upon the good sense, the energy and the justice of his subordinates. By Order of Bvt. Maj. Gen. Fisk Asst. Comr. Ky. & Tenn. J.E. Jacobs Bvt. Lt. Col. A.A.G. Trotter, F.E. Lt. Col. Supt. &c. Chattanooga Tenn. Endorsement on application of E. Powell, dated Atlanta, Ga. Feb. 20 1866, for restoration of property. L.R. P.28 A.C. Ky. & Tenn. 1866. Bureau R.F. & A. L. Asst. Comr. Office, Nashville, Feb. 28 1866 Respectfully referred to Lieut. Col. F.E. Trotter, Supt. Chattanooga, Tenn. who is hereby directed to thoroughly examine this case and report to this office. No application for the registration of this property has yet been received at this Office. These papers to be returned. By Order of Bvt. Maj. Gen. Fisk Asst. Comr, Ky. & Tenn. H.S. Brown Capt. & A.A.G. 76 Henry John R. Spec. Agent Knoxville Tenn. Endorsements on letter of John R.
